Paralegal
The candidate will assist Staff Attorneys and DOJ Accredited Representatives prepare their cases and filings for all types of immigration cases. Will assist with client and case management as needed. Carry a case load under attorney supervision and will assist with immigration clinics including weekends and evenings. Paralegal will assist in Triage (in person consultation intake system) which requires 7 AM -- 3 PM work schedule and alternating Saturday mornings 7 AM- 11 AM. Assist the Supervising Attorney(s) in screening potential non-citizens for all potential immigration relief. Assist the Attorney(s) on the daily delivery of legal services and case management. Attend clinics and Triage as schedule on Tuesday, Thursdays and Saturdays. Assist clients in their immigration case from intake to adjudication under attorney supervision. Prepare for DOJ accreditation. Attend legal context trainings to become familiar in legal services the organization provides. Collect client data for grant reporting purposes. Provide overall office support, as requested by Attorney(s). Calendar case deadline and appointments. Assist clients with filling out applications for relief. Translate documents from Spanish into English. Prepare various immigration filings. Assist clients with declarations. Assist with development of systems and procedures help to more efficiently manage case load. Other duties and responsibilities as necessary. Should have Bachelor’s degree or related field experience. Prior experience filling out USCIS forms and applications preferred. Prior experience helping clients who are victims of violence, including conducting client
interviews preferred. Spanish fluency is required as the job requires extensive legal counseling and representation in the Spanish language.
